The Door Installation Process
Understanding the door installation procedure can help homeowners value the worth of working with a professional installer. Here's a detailed overview of what to anticipate:
- Consultation: Discuss your preferences, style, and any interest in the installer. This stage sets the foundation for the project.
- Measurements: The installer will measure door frames to ensure the new door fits seamlessly.
- Door Selection: Choose a door that fits your style, performance needs, and budget.
- Preparation: This consists of removing the old door, inspecting the frame for rot or damage, and preparing the area.
- Hanging the Door: The new door is hung using hinges, which includes accurate changes to ensure it opens and closes efficiently.
- Sealing and Weatherproofing: Proper sealing is crucial for energy efficiency. This might involve setting up weatherstripping or applying caulking.
- Ending up Touches: Finally, the installer will add any necessary hardware, such as manages or locks, and make sure whatever functions perfectly.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How long does a door installation take?A1: Generally, door setups can take anywhere from a few hours to a complete day, depending on the intricacy of the job and any unanticipated problems.
Q2: What kinds of doors can experts install?A2: Professionals can
install numerous types of doors, consisting of interior doors, exterior doors, sliding doors, French doors, and storm doors.
Q3: Is it needed to eliminate the old door before installation?A3: Yes, the old door needs to be eliminated to make sure the new door fits correctly and to examine the frame for damage. Q4: Do I require a license to set up a new door?A4: It depends
on local structure codes and regulations. Consulting with a professional installer can clarify if a license is needed. Q5: How can I keep my new door after installation?A5: Regular upkeep involves cleaning, examining
seals, and lubricating hinges to guarantee enduring performance.
